A small South Wales charity is looking for volunteers to help individuals affected by brain injuries.
Headway Cardiff and South Wales is based in University Hospital Llandough, the organisation provides vital support to people who have had their lives changed due to an accident or illness and have been affected by a brain injury.
They help to adjust to the changes and look to help them maximise their independence, wellbeing, health and quality of life.
Enthusiastic, caring and sensitive individuals are called upon to engage with service users, assisting them in partaking in activities and with carrying out practical tasks such as making refreshments or tidying up.
Vacancies are available on Mondays and Fridays from 10.30am to 3pm.
